What they do

An Inventory or Supply Specialist specializes in tracking and managing inventory and supplies to improve production or distribution at a company or organization. Manages purchase orders, or distribution of materials between different centers of a large company.

Job Description

Overview
AMERICAN SYSTEMS
is an employee-owned federal government contractor supporting national priority programs through our strategic solutions in the areas of Information Technology, Test & Evaluation, Program Mission Support, Engineering & Analysis, and Training. Responsibilities Configuration management and supply support tasking for several classes of submarines. Parts research and data gathering to support Virginia Class program office data calls. Information to be gathered may include stock posture, stock availability, obsolescence status, and more. Data entry to update IUID registry. Research reference material (instructions, guidance…) to incorporate into program documents. Creation and maintenance of Excel spreadsheets for tracking requisition information. Recording meeting minutes, action item tracking, gathering of weekly inputs to provide consolidated reports or material for briefs. Qualifications High School diploma 2+ years of related work experience Active Secret Clearance U.S. Citizenship Required for the purposes of obtaining/holding a U.S. security clearance Attention to Detail, sense of urgency Ability to create, update, and track tasks Proficient in Microsoft Word, PowerPoint, Excel, and Power Apps (like Power BI) Ability to take Word documents, tables, and charts, and create/maintain Online desk guides Quickly create PowerPoint graphics Ability to quickly spot spelling and grammatical mistakes Type meeting notes real time, sending out accurate notes in short order Ability to explain complex technical information in common, simple language Knowledge of the Navy Supply System and processes would be beneficial but not required Pay Transparency Statement
